Why Yuba City homes and companies gain from solar

The regional environment does a great deal of the heavy training. Regular annual solar production right here sits in the range of 1,450 to 1,650 kilowatt-hours each year for every kilowatt of DC ability, relying on tilt, azimuth, shading, and module choice. That suggests a 7 kW roof covering range can produce approximately 10,000 to 11,000 kWh yearly when sited well. Since most single-family homes around Yuba City usage in between 7,000 and 15,000 kWh a year, a right-sized system can balance out a large share of usage.

Electric rates fan to the case. Lots of PG&E Time-of-Use plans push summertime mid-day and night prices well over 30 cents per kWh, with the greatest costs touchdown after the sun dips. That is why batteries significantly turn up in layouts. Under California's Internet Payment Toll, frequently called NEM 3.0, the utility pays you an avoided-cost based export price for excess solar sent out to the grid. Midday export credit histories are modest. Storing power in a battery and discharging throughout height periods increases bill cost savings and speeds repayment compared with solar alone in many cases.

For commercial homes, the equation consists of demand charges. Solar can decrease kWh fees, and smart controls plus storage space can cut late mid-day tops. Farming operations around Sutter Region, with pumps running throughout irrigation season, can additionally take advantage of ground mounts or carport arrays sized around operating schedules.

What transformed with NEM 3.0 and why it impacts style choices

California shifted from typical net metering to a Net Invoicing Tariff in April 2023 for brand-new interconnections. Instead of one-for-one credit scores, exports make variable prices that change by hour and month. In summer season mid-days, credit reports often land in the teens of cents. In spring lunchtime, credit ratings can drop to a couple of cents. Evening debts often climb higher, however already panels are not generating much.

Two functional takeaways:

  • Right-sizing issues. Oversizing a system to go after credit scores is less beneficial than it utilized to be. Your solar carriers need to model hourly production and load against reasonable export values, not just guarantee a percentage offset.
  • Storage is no more a luxury add-on. A battery allows you keep cheap solar at midday and discharge during the 4 to 9 pm home window. That change can raise the efficient value of each kWh you generate. For many households, a solitary 10 to 13.5 kWh battery can cover crucial loads and meaningful optimal usage, particularly with load management.

If a sales associate glosses over Internet Invoicing mechanics or declines to share an hour-by-hour design, maintain looking. Top solar firms in Yuba City explain exactly how your home's patterns map to the toll and why they chose a certain inverter or battery.

Permit, interconnection, and inspection in Yuba City

City and area building departments run predictable processes, yet timetables change with workload. A simple domestic solar panel installment in Yuba City normally requires:

  • Building and electrical licenses. Plan sets have to fulfill California Electrical Code, structural criteria for wind and seismic, and fire obstacle guidelines for roof covering access. A lot of prepare customers look for UL listings on devices, clear labeling, and conductor sizing that matches the design.
  • If you stay in an HOA, the California Solar Rights Act restricts an HOA's capacity to obstruct solar, yet they can impose sensible aesthetic standards. Provide your installer any kind of HOA policies upfront to avoid rework.
  • Interconnection with PG&E under the Web Payment Tariff. After last evaluation, the installer submits closure documents. Consent to Operate can take days to a few weeks depending upon the queue.

For organizations or ground mounts in the region, you might include preparing evaluation, trenching inspections, or structural details for covers. Ask your contractor which department manages your address, whether they make use of digital submittals, and existing turnaround times. An honest answer defeats a positive promise.

Pricing in the location and what drives it

Solar panel setup rates differs with roof complexity, devices tier, and storage. In the greater Yuba City market, you are likely to see these ball parks before rewards:

  • Residential solar just: generally 2.75 to 3.75 bucks per watt DC. A 7 kW system may land in between 19,000 and 26,000 dollars.
  • Solar plus one battery: typically 30,000 to 42,000 dollars for a 7 kW selection coupled with a 10 to 13.5 kWh battery, relying on brand name and labor complexity.
  • Additional batteries add substantial expense however can improve interruption performance and height shaving for huge homes.

The 30 percent government Financial investment Tax Credit report relates to commercial solar panel installation Yuba City both solar and storage space if the battery is billed largely from the solar array. The golden state's Self-Generation Incentive Program offers battery discounts that differ by customer classification and spending plan condition. Funds move fast and needs change. Top installers check SGIP schedule and register you proactively.

An usual sales method is to price estimate a reduced per-watt price with lower efficiency components, after that quietly include a pricey electrical upgrade at the end. Firmly insist that bids consist of all near costs: main panel upgrade, trenching, critter guard, surveillance, permit charges, and potential architectural reinforcements.

Local roof coverings, devices options, and why information matter

Most Yuba City homes have composite roof shingles roofing systems with rafters at 16 or 24 inches on center. Rafter design, pitch, and shading from bordering trees or second-story walls will form layout. Spanish floor Yuba City rooftop solar panel installation tile or steel standing joint are likewise usual in brand-new builds and country residential or commercial properties. Tile requires mindful handling or replacement with a mounting system that protects waterproofing. Standing seam can be a dream for installers thanks to clamp-on add-ons that avoid roofing system penetrations.

Inverters and optimizers are not just the same. For intricate roofs with several airplanes or partial shading, module-level power electronic devices such as microinverters or DC optimizers preserve production when one module is shaded. For easier layouts, a top quality string inverter with quick closure tools can be extra economical and similarly dependable. Your photovoltaic panel companies must match equipment to your design and spending plan, not push whichever brand has an existing rebate.

Durability matters in the Sacramento Valley warmth. Try to find components examined for high temperature performance, with decent temperature coefficients and service warranties that show less than 0.5 percent yearly destruction. Ask about wind lots ratings, rodent protection for wiring, and corrosion resistance if you are near agricultural chemicals or dust.

Comparing quotes apples to apples

Sales proposals are not standard, so you require to stabilize them. Line up the basics:

  • DC system dimension, a/c system size, and anticipated first-year production. If 2 bids suggest the very same kilowatts yet one predicts 12 percent much more energy, ask what assumptions differ.
  • Module brand name, effectiveness, and guarantees. A module with a 25 year item warranty and a 0.4 percent yearly destruction price is not comparable to a panel with 12 years and 0.7 percent.
  • Inverter kind and substitute outlook. Inverters usually have 10 to 25 year guarantees. If the warranty is shorter than your repayment duration, element a substitute right into life time cost.
  • Battery chemistry, ability, and functional energy. A 13.5 kWh battery may have 100 percent usable ability while an additional lists 90 percent. Confirm continuous and peak power ratings for back-up loads.
  • Electrical upgrades. A primary service panel upgrade can include 2,000 to 4,000 dollars or even more. Sometimes a line-side tap or tons management avoids the upgrade securely and legally.

Do not fail to remember looks and channel directing. If a professional intends to run channel across your front frontage to get to the meter, ask for alternate routes. Skilled teams usually locate cleaner paths.

What the site browse through ought to cover

Many credible solar firms send a field professional prior to finalizing your contract. They gauge roof covering aircrafts, picture rafters in the attic, testimonial primary panel area, and examine grounding and bonding. If they do a rushed online evaluation without inquiring about your attic gain access to or roof age, you could see surprise adjustment orders later.

Here is what a detailed see reveals: the exact rafter layout for installing hardware spacing, real-world shading from vents or neighboring trees, roofing system problem that could warrant repair work or replacement, and main panel bus ranking that determines whether a breaker backfeed serves. Expect them to request a complete year of energy bills and any type of plans to add EV billing, swimming pool devices, or heat pump heating and cooling. These changes shift load profiles and can justify a slightly larger variety or a different battery size.

Timelines and what can speed them up

Once you sign, layout and permitting can take 2 to 4 weeks for a common residential project. Installation typically takes one to three days. Evaluation organizing includes a few days. Affiliation authorization from PG&E can vary from much less than a week to a couple of weeks depending upon volume.

You can help by offering HOA authorizations early, guaranteeing someone is offered for attic accessibility during gauging and set up, and sharing utility logins for meter information imports. If your job requires a major panel upgrade, coordinate with any kind of landscapers or gateway locks so the crew can trench or access the meter wall without delay.

Financing options and trade-offs

Cash provides the best overall return and easiest possession. Car loans spread out prices, though interest can eat several commercial solar power companies near me of the financial savings. If you choose a funding, checked out the small print on dealer fees. A so-called 0 percent financing commonly bakes a sizable cost into the task rate. Compare the out-the-door cost across deals, not just the month-to-month payment.

Leases and power purchase contracts promise reduced or no ahead of time price, which can help if you do not get approved for the tax obligation credit scores or like an operating costs. In exchange, you quit the ITC and long-lasting advantage. Pay cautious attention to escalators, buyout choices, and solution terms. In the Yuba City area, rents make one of the most feeling for clients that can not utilize the tax obligation credit scores or who value a naturally managed property without possession responsibilities.

Batteries, back-up, and reasonable expectations

During wildfire season or tornado outages, batteries beam by keeping fundamentals running. A common 10 to 13.5 kWh battery can power lights, electrical outlets, the refrigerator, web, and a gas heating system blower for numerous hours. Running central air on battery alone drains capability promptly. Some homes install soft-start gadgets for AC compressors or select load-shedding panels that go down unnecessary circuits during backup.

For pure expense financial savings under Net Billing, batteries earn their maintain by cutting the 4 to 9 pm home window. The right settings matter. Your installer ought to configure time-based control to pre-charge the battery with solar, book a slice for backup if you wish, and discharge during the highest-cost durations. Maintenance, tracking, and warranty support

Modern systems are low maintenance. Dirt and plant pollen decrease outcome somewhat in springtime, however summertime warmth frequently brings periodic dry winds that aid. If you see a continual 10 to 20 percent drop beyond seasonal standards, a mild rinse in the early morning can aid. Stay clear of rough chemicals or rough pads. Security initially if your roofing is steep.

Monitoring apps reveal everyday production and, with wise meters or CTs, intake. Check regular monthly that production aligns with the installer's quote after representing weather. If a microinverter goes down or a string underperforms, great solar business respond without delay. Maintain your paperwork organized: module and inverter identification numbers, guarantees, and the single-line diagram. If you offer your home, that package smooths the evaluation and transfer.

Special notes for ranches and little businesses

Agricultural pumps, freezer, and small manufacturing bring special demands. Three-phase service, lengthy conductor goes to sheds, and dust direct exposure require rugged styles and interest to cable sizing and voltage decrease. Ground mounts can be perfect where roof coverings are shaded or messy. For canopies over devices backyards or parking, see solar panel installation contractors to it structural design make up wind uplift and the local dirt class if making use of deep piers.

Commercial financing might include resources leases, PACE in some jurisdictions, or conventional lendings with MACRS depreciation and reward devaluation at the government level, along with the 30 percent ITC. A skilled business installer will model both energy financial savings and need cost reduction making use of interval information, not averages.
